It's still more than 2 years prior the 2010 National Elections in the Philippines, and yet a lot of names have surfaced regarding who will replace Gloria Macapagal-Arroyo. The list of possible candidates are not at all surprising- same people. The names of Vice President Noli De Castro, MMDA Chairman Bayani Fernando, Sen. Mar Roxas, Sen. Manny Villar, Mayor Sonny Belmonte and even Defense Secretary Gilberto Teodoro all came out in the list of the so-called presidentiables.

As of today, one cannot really say who among the possibe candidates will win or at the very least who might win. As of now, all candidates are on the same platform. No one yet could tell who will reside in Malacanyang in 2010. A lot of events could still happen and everyone, even the popular ones, is not assured of that exclusive seat.
